Duties and Responsibilities
Responsible for ensuring the rules and regulations set forth by the Gaming Boards regarding the operation of the CCTV surveillance systems are adhered to
Responsible for ensuring that the guidelines set forth by the company are adhered to
By way of the CCTV system, Surveillance Operators maintain constant camera patrol of the casino covertly observe, interpret and report on all activities on the casino floor in support areas including but not necessarily limited to all casino table games and pits, slots, cashier cage, count room and exterior perimeter of the property
Monitoring will be done to identify the following:
Cheating or stealing by players and employees acting alone or in concert with one another
Failure of employees to follow proper procedures
The treatment of drop boxes, cash storage boxes and other gaming equipment (eg. Cards, dice, dealing shoes, etc.)
Treatment of ill, drunk or disorderly persons evicted and detained or arrested persons and persons and suspected casino cheats
All movement of cash or chips on the premises
Will take responsibility for the directing operation in the monitor room in any given situation in the absence of supervision but must notify management in a timely fashion
Will develop a broad working knowledge of the company accounting and internal controls and rules governing the conduct of all table games, slots and cage operations as well as all operations within the casino
Other duties as assigned by Management
